Make sure your website is as Search Engine friendly as possible.
Unique content Unique META data for every page Good internal link structure As many relevant backlinks as you can get! Do all this and keep adding your website to the free directories and you'll start to rank well. It doesn't happen overnight, be patient and persistent, it'll happen for you.

HR and Recruitment are very competitive. Therefore, try picking off low hanging fruit to start with i.e. niche / targeted keywords to start with.
Leads from such keywords generally convert quicker also.

But look at your SEO as if you were carrying out an online public relations campaign - get some good articles out there which are relevant and themed to what you do and get them published on third party sites with links back to your site... The basics will then be in place and don't give in - SEO takes longer than you'd think! It may be an idea to start with a Paid Search campaign at a nominal budget to get traffic to your site whilst the Search Engines are learning to be more favourable to your site - and then reducing it once you're ranking in the SERPs (search Engine Results Pages)...
